Scope of the role:
The Quality Engineer plays a key role within the Quality Department, ensuring that products, processes, and systems consistently meet internal, customer, and regulatory requirements. This position is responsible for monitoring, evaluating, and improving both supplier and internal manufacturing and assembly performance using established quality methodologies, data analysis, and KPIs. The role works cross-functionally with suppliers, customers, and internal teams to drive a culture of operational excellence and a strong Right First Time mindset. The Quality Engineer will actively contribute to continuous improvement initiatives, customer satisfaction, audit readiness, and the ongoing development of the Integrated Management System (IMS).
Main duties and responsibilities:
Quality Assurance & Compliance
• Ensure supplied and internally manufactured products comply with engineering drawings, manufacturing specifications, and all applicable company, customer, and statutory standards.
• Support and maintain compliance with ISO 9001 requirements and contribute to continuous improvement of the Integrated Management System (IMS). Knowledge of ISO 14001 & 45001 would be advantageous.
• Act as a recognised point of contact for all quality-related issues within the business. Supplier, Customer & Internal Interface
• Liaise directly with suppliers, customers, and internal functions to investigate non-conformances and ensure effective corrective and preventive actions (CAPA) are implemented.
• Monitor supplier quality performance, support supplier development activities, and drive improvements where required.
• Ensure customer complaints are managed effectively, with clear communication and timely resolution.
Continuous Improvement & Problem Solving
• Lead structured problem-solving activities, including 8D investigations, root cause analysis (5 Why), and corrective action planning.
• Identify quality improvement opportunities and implement robust plans to improve product quality and overall performance.
• Promote and embed a culture of continuous improvement, operational excellence, and Right First Time thinking across the business.
Audits & Reporting
• Support external ISO audits and regulatory assessments.
• Plan and perform internal IMS audits, supplier audits, and Safety Walks.
• Coordinate quality data collection, analysis, and reporting, sharing best practice and lessons learned across the business.
• Track and report quality KPIs, including PPM, Pareto analysis and trends.
Coaching, Support & Collaboration
• Provide coaching, guidance, and support to team members on quality tools, procedures, and best practices.
• Work closely with all support functions (Engineering, Manufacturing, Production, Supply Chain, HSE, etc.) on quality-related matters.

Key skills requirements:
Essential
• Proven experience in a Quality Engineering or Quality Assurance role within a manufacturing or production environment.
• Strong knowledge of manufacturing and assembly processes.
• Minimum HNC, or HND qualification (or equivalent experience).
• Completed 4-year mechanical apprenticeship.
• Demonstrated ability to apply quality methodologies and tools, including:
o 8D problem-solving
o 5 Why analysis
o Pareto analysis
o PPM performance monitoring
Desirable
• Experience in Combined QHSE environments and involvement in safety initiatives.
• Experience conducting internal, supplier, and system audits.
• Previous involvement in process improvement and lean initiatives.
• Experience supporting or leading ISO certification audits.
• Six Sigma certification, minimum Green Belt .
